Katie draws on her extensive experience in private practice and government enforcement to skillfully represent clients in complex antitrust matters.
Katie leverages her experience at the Federal Trade Commission and in private practice to offer a unique perspective on how regulators approach antitrust cases. Prior to joining the firm, Katie worked in the Mergers IV Division of the Federal Trade Commission, where she investigated matters across healthcare, consumer products, grocery, and retail industries, and litigated in federal court. Before joining the Federal Trade Commission, Katie worked in the antitrust practice group of an Am Law-listed firm, where she provided antitrust counseling and represented clients in dozens of merger investigations, as well as price-fixing and consumer protection matters.
